Just curious, I love Zumba and wondering how quick you were able to get back to it after surgery? I'm scheduled for sleeve on 2-25-13.

I was walking right away but I'm trying to think about Zumba and remember what my recovery was like (mine was a dream too). My dumb guess is probably 4-6 weeks to do high-impact cardio. Zumba can be pretty core intense (depending on how aggressive you are) and your abdomen will be sensitive and healing for a while.

My surgeon was very "if it hurts, don't do it" with recovery but all I was doing was walking. Each surgeon has guidelines they like their patients to follow during recovery so check it out with their office and go with what they tell you!

Good luck! You'll be back to Zumba in no time!

I did Zumba week 3 but didn't feel fully energetic enough until week 4. I had dull pain when jumping around the first week but I just stopped and tried again another day and I'm fine. You'll do great!

I think six weeks if ur not modifying any moves. It depends on the instructor and how much ur really moving. Zumba can be quite the workout. Talk to ur surgeon, but the general rule of thumb is four to six weeks. There's a whole lotta of booty and belly shaking. Moving the abdominal muscles in that fashion too soon could lead to some major discomfort. Good luck!
